TAX CREDITS HELP B.C. PINCH FILM PROJECTS FROM SEATTLE
Give us your Microsoft, Seattle, your Starbucks and, while you're at it, your film industry. Seattle's pain is Vancouver's gain when it comes to the film industry, thanks to B.C.'s tax credits, according to folks in the business.

CALIFORNIA TO HIKE FILM TAX CREDITS FROM $100M TO $400M
Moving to slow the exodus of filming to other states and countries, California lawmakers are poised to quadruple tax subsidies for location shooting to $400 million a year.

WINNIPEG FILM INDUSTRY PREPARES FOR BUSY FALL
After a relatively dry summer, Manitoba will see a bumper crop of film production as cameras will start rolling in earnest this fall. Local production company Buffalo Gal Pictures has placed itself firmly at the centre of the storm with a hand in four of those five new projects.

VANCOUVER FRINGE FESTIVAL
September 4 - 14
The Vancouver Fringe is a celebration of every kind of theatre imaginable. Produced annually by the First Vancouver Theatrespace Society over 11 days in September. The Fringe strives to break down traditional boundaries and encourage open dialogue between audiences and artists by presenting live un-juried, uncensored theatre in an accessible and informal environment. All artists receive 100% of regular box office revenues generated during the Festival.
